To Goran she says. Apparently they stand in a circle and have to come up with a pun about a given subject. They believe that if it's good and original enough, Zon-Kuthon will bless the punster with the ability to cause pain to the others because of the pun. If you can't come up with a pun, you're out and subject to later ridicule unless you were previously blessed. Last person standing in the Ruling Punster.

Personally I like puns because one needs to be well read and quick witted. It is said that the pun is the more intellectual form of humour

I have yet to master the more intricate form though. It's called a Feghoot after a writer who published a whole series of them. Other writers have since copied this form and there are quite a few examples in my library. Basically a Feghoot is a short story that ends in a pun, the more unexpected the better She pauses for a moment There is this story about Stein the Wizard who was sentenced to seven days imprisonment for something or other. On the day before his sentence, he used some sort of time spell to skip ahead seven years and one day. When he reappeared there was this argument about whether he had served his sentence or not. The Adjudicator finally settled it by saying "A niche in time saves Stein"

After a hurried early morning rush to gather supplies in Absalom, several days in the blustery Inner Sea, and another spent weaving through the bureaucracy of the Taldan customs rituals, you find yourself walking through a chilly, early morning rain storm and approaching what the vagabond locals say is the location of the burned-out temple to Sarenrae.

Rain patters down in sheets over the scorched skeleton of a once majestic temple. Walls of thick, blackened masonry stand tall and abandoned, with gaping wounds revealing where stained glass windows once caught the morning sun. The roof has collapsed and most of its remnants are long gone. Only large, immovable remnants of the crumbling masonry remain in the rubble piles scattered throughout the ruin.

All that remains inside this ruin are rocks and chunks of wood either too worn down and ruined to be of use or too heavy to carry away. There are signs that this place has been used in the past for shelter, but it has since completely collapsed, and most of the residents of the vagabond camp seem to give it wide berth.

Two sets of ruined stairs in the temples south wall lead up to a once proud pulpit. At the back of the pulpit, an enormous stone lid, several hundred pounds in weight, has been pulled off a set of stairs leading down into darkness.

Map of the burned-out temple now on Slides.

The former consul of Oppara, Magistros Sebastus Hustavan, is here, currently being menaced by a pack of wild dogs. Hustavan is well over 6 feet tall, shockingly thin, and quite old. His head is balding and fringed by frizzled gray hair. His chin and cheeks are covered in several weeks’ worth of beard growth, the gray hairs standing out against his pale, leathery skin. He wears long white robes, muddy, torn, and ragged, and wears what looks to be a blue sash tied around his waist as a belt. The dogs are mangy, dirty things that wander the fringes of the vagabond camp in search of food or easy prey.

When you arrive, Hustavan stands on the pulpit, which stands ten feet above the remains of the temple's stone floor. He’s wielding a long piece of wet, rotting wood and is just barely keeping a pack of ferocious canines at bay.

As you enter the temple ruins, the creatures abandon Hustavan to his perch and turn to attack.
